
It's almost time to change the clocks, and while we gain an hour of sleep we will also lose some daylight. Recently, celebrity fitness consultant Bob Greene offered some exercise suggestions to help beat the winter blues that can come with those cold, dark days and boost your energy and mood.
First, switch up your workout routine - because you make not even be doing it right in the first place.
"Focus on incline - not speed. Want a more challenging treadmill workout? Don't focus on picking up the pace. In fact, you don't have to run at all. Instead, simply increase the incline. Walking on an incline is a terrific workout that is a lot easier on your joints," said Greene.
Next, Greene suggested looking at your diet to make sure you're getting enough healthy fats. Things such as olive oil and avocados are filled with "good" fats, while red meat, cream, whole and two percent milk have the wrong kind.
Finally, getting enough rest is important to let the body recover after a workout.
